Runbook — Emberlight Admin, dark-mode release. After merging the theme branch, run the visual regression suite and confirm contrast checks pass. Build the dashboard bundle, tag it, and push to the staging registry. Before promotion to production, the artifact must be signed; use the deploy key listed below.

rollout seal: bky4_x7Gc

Subject: DR drill next Thursday — StormPing fan-out

Hey Marit,

Quick heads-up before you review the failover PR: we're running the disaster-recovery drill for the StormPing weather-alert fan-out on Thursday. We'll kill the primary broker in the Valtheim region and watch alerts reroute through the cold standby. Please double-check the retry logic in the dispatcher diff — that's the bit we're exercising. To unseal the standby's config vault during the drill, use the passphrase below.

vault phrase of bagaf-kajeg = jorath-feniel-briir-siliel-ralix

## Build Provenance: Ledgerpane Audit-Log Viewer

Every published build of the Ledgerpane viewer is produced by the hermetic Coalhouse pipeline; plugin authors should verify provenance before linking against its SDK. Each artifact bundle carries a signed manifest listing source revision, builder image, and dependency digests. To confirm you hold an authentic release, compare your bundle against the attestation token recorded below.

session token of bawep-yadup = htk21_528abd376e3c5a4ec24a1

## Step 4 — Update Reconnect Handling

Plugins built against Hollowgate SDK 2.x must drop custom reconnect loops. The 3.0 runtime handles websocket reconnects natively; the old loops race the runtime and cause duplicate sessions, the bug behind most 2.x support reports. Remove any `onDrop` retry handlers and rely on the runtime events instead. Your plugin manifest must declare the new transport block, with these required values.

settings of fafog-haduf:
ZORIX_PIN=4648
ZORIX_METRICS_HOST=metrics.zorix.paliqsys.corp
ZORIX_LOG_LEVEL=info
ZORIX_TENANT=druix